In a world saturated with apps and games vying for attention, the most powerful innovations often aren’t born from a boardroom, but from a passionate fan. Meet Sprunki, the fan-made, browser-based music game that is taking the digital world by storm. It’s a platform that doesn’t just borrow from its inspiration, Incredibox; it reinvents it, proving that a deep understanding of community and a commitment to pure creativity can lead to unexpected viral success.

Sprunki isn’t just another game. It’s a masterclass in how to build a product that resonates deeply with its audience—by giving them exactly what they want, without the friction of ads or paywalls. At its core, Sprunki is an intuitive music creation tool. Users drag and drop different sound elements onto animated characters, known as Sprunkis, to compose their own unique music tracks. But the real magic lies in its community-driven mods and its strategic approach to growth.

The Secret to Sprunki’s Success: Mods and Momentum

While the original Incredibox is a beloved game, Sprunki.com differentiated itself by leaning into the power of creative modification. Instead of offering a single, static experience, Sprunki became a canvas for endless creativity. This approach unlocked a powerful growth loop. By allowing the community to create and share diverse mods—from underwater themes to dark modes and even Pokémon-inspired versions—the platform created a constant stream of fresh, engaging content.

This strategy served a dual purpose: it kept existing users engaged and coming back for more, while also drawing in new players intrigued by a specific mod. The sheer variety caters to both casual players looking for a quick, fun experience and dedicated music enthusiasts who want to explore different sonic palettes. The Counter-Intuitive Business Model: Zero Ads, Maximum Impact

In an age where monetization often takes precedence over user experience, Sprunki’s most striking feature is its clean, user-friendly interface with no ads or in-app purchases in many of its versions. This commitment to a seamless, uninterrupted experience is a powerful testament to the value of a user-first approach.

For many founders, the immediate question is, “How do they make money?” But for Sprunki, the focus isn’t on direct revenue; it’s on building a massive, loyal community. This model of building value first and exploring monetization later is a bold, but increasingly viable, strategy for digital products. By eliminating the friction of advertising, Sprunki.com built trust and fostered a sense of community ownership. The resulting word-of-mouth marketing is more effective than any ad campaign. The platform’s growing popularity is a direct result of this trust, demonstrating that a commitment to a pure user experience can be a founder’s most powerful marketing tool.

Key Lessons from the Sprunki Story

The journey of Sprunki offers several actionable takeaways for aspiring startup founders:

  • Empower Your Community: Don’t just listen to your users; give them the tools to contribute and create. Community-driven content is a powerful engine for growth and engagement.
  • Prioritize the User Experience: In the early stages, a flawless, ad-free experience can be a more effective growth strategy than aggressive monetization. It builds trust and encourages organic spread.
  • Build on What Works: Sprunki didn’t invent the music-mixing game; it took a proven concept and added a unique, differentiating twist (mods). This “remixing” of an existing idea can be a low-risk way to enter a market.
  • Leverage Viral Mechanics: The ability for users to easily share their musical creations online is a key virality driver. This feature turns every user into a potential brand ambassador.
